In Drosophila melanogaster, cherub wings (ch). black body (b) and cinnabar eyes (cn) are recessive to their corresponding alleles (represented as ch+, b+, and cn+, respectively) and are all located on chromosome 2.Homozygous wild type flies were mated with cherub, black, and cinnabar flies and the resulting F1 females were tests crossed with cherub, black and cinnabar males. The following progeny were produced from the testcross:
ch b + cn 110
ch + b + cn + 780
ch + b cn 70
ch + b + cn 6
ch b cn 769
ch b + cn + 60
ch + b cn + 111
ch b cn + 9
Total 1915
Of these three genes, which one is in the middle?
(a) The locus that determines cherub wings.
(b) The locus that determines cinnabar eyes.
(c) The locus that determines black body.
(d) Cannot be determined from the given data.
